Tar Oil, Rectified
Title: Tar Oil, Rectified
Additional Names: Pine tar oil
Literature References: The volatile oil from pine tar rectified by steam distillation. Chief active constituents are phenolic substances.
Properties: Dark reddish-brown, thin liquid; strong empyreumatic odor and taste. d2525 0.960-0.990. Insol in water; miscible with alcohol.
Density: d2525 0.960-0.990
Therap-Cat: Antiseptic (topical); dermatologic.
Therap-Cat-Vet: Antiseptic, antipruritic. For chronic skin conditions and in hoof dressings. Has been used internally as an expectorant.
